Home
last modified time | relevance | path

Searched refs:kCodeOffset (Results 1 - 25 of 47) sorted by relevance

12

/third_party/node/deps/v8/src/objects/
H A Djs-function-inl.h72 ACCESSORS_RELAXED(JSFunction, code, CodeT, kCodeOffset)
73 RELEASE_ACQUIRE_ACCESSORS(JSFunction, code, CodeT, kCodeOffset)
236 Object maybe_code = ACQUIRE_READ_FIELD(*this, kCodeOffset); in ShouldFlushBaselineCode()
253 Object maybe_code = ACQUIRE_READ_FIELD(*this, kCodeOffset); in NeedsResetDueToFlushedBytecode()
H A Dcode-inl.h912 CodeDataContainer::kCodeOffset + kTaggedSize),
928 Object value = TaggedField<Object, kCodeOffset>::load(cage_base, *this); in raw_code()
934 TaggedField<Object, kCodeOffset>::store(*this, value); in set_raw_code()
935 CONDITIONAL_WRITE_BARRIER(*this, kCodeOffset, value, mode); in set_raw_code()
946 TaggedField<Object, kCodeOffset>::Relaxed_Load(cage_base, *this); in raw_code()
H A Dobjects-body-descriptors-inl.h354 IteratePointers(obj, kStartOffset, kCodeOffset, v); in IterateBody()
359 IterateCustomWeakPointer(obj, kCodeOffset, v); in IterateBody()
361 DCHECK_GE(header_size, kCodeOffset); in IterateBody()
362 IteratePointers(obj, kCodeOffset + kTaggedSize, header_size, v); in IterateBody()
999 v->VisitCodePointer(obj, obj.RawCodeField(kCodeOffset));
H A Dsource-text-module.h77 FixedBodyDescriptor<kCodeOffset, kSize, kSize>>;
H A Dcode.h173 V(kCodeOffset, V8_EXTERNAL_CODE_SPACE_BOOL ? kTaggedSize : 0) \
/third_party/node/deps/v8/src/builtins/
H A Dbuiltins-lazy-gen.cc98 StoreObjectField(function, JSFunction::kCodeOffset, optimized_code); in MaybeTailCallOptimizedCodeSlot()
134 StoreObjectField(function, JSFunction::kCodeOffset, sfi_code); in CompileLazy()
190 StoreObjectField(function, JSFunction::kCodeOffset, code); in TF_BUILTIN()
H A Dbuiltins-async-gen.cc184 StoreObjectFieldNoWriteBarrier(function, JSFunction::kCodeOffset, code); in InitializeNativeClosure()
H A Dbuiltins-constructor-gen.cc259 StoreObjectFieldNoWriteBarrier(result, JSFunction::kCodeOffset, lazy_builtin); in TF_BUILTIN()
/third_party/node/deps/v8/src/regexp/
H A Dregexp-compiler.h523 static const int kCodeOffset = 1; member in v8::internal::RegExpCompiler
/third_party/node/deps/v8/src/heap/
H A Dmarking-visitor-inl.h168 VisitPointer(js_function, js_function.RawField(JSFunction::kCodeOffset)); in VisitJSFunction()
H A Dmark-compact.cc2766 ObjectSlot slot = flushed_js_function.RawField(JSFunction::kCodeOffset); in ProcessFlushedBaselineCandidates()
3279 slot.address() - CodeDataContainer::kCodeOffset)); in UpdateStrongCodeSlot()
4439 slot.address() - CodeDataContainer::kCodeOffset); in UpdateUntypedPointers()
/third_party/node/deps/v8/src/codegen/arm64/
H A Dmacro-assembler-arm64.cc2157 CodeDataContainer::kCodeOffset + kTaggedSize)); in LoadCodeDataContainerCodeNonBuiltin()
2159 CodeDataContainer::kCodeOffset)); in LoadCodeDataContainerCodeNonBuiltin()
2466 FieldMemOperand(function, JSFunction::kCodeOffset)); in InvokeFunctionCode()
/third_party/node/deps/v8/src/codegen/x64/
H A Dmacro-assembler-x64.cc2016 CodeDataContainer::kCodeOffset + kTaggedSize)); in CallRecordWriteStub()
2018 CodeDataContainer::kCodeOffset)); in CallRecordWriteStub()
2569 LoadTaggedPointerField(rcx, FieldOperand(function, JSFunction::kCodeOffset)); in CallRecordWriteStub()
/third_party/node/deps/v8/src/compiler/
H A Daccess-builder.cc199 FieldAccess access = {kTaggedBase, JSFunction::kCodeOffset, in ForJSFunctionCode()
/third_party/node/deps/v8/src/builtins/mips/
H A Dbuiltins-mips.cc766 __ lw(a2, FieldMemOperand(a1, JSFunction::kCodeOffset)); in Generate_ResumeGeneratorTrampoline()
808 __ sw(optimized_code, FieldMemOperand(closure, JSFunction::kCodeOffset)); in ReplaceClosureCodeWithOptimizedCode()
810 __ RecordWriteField(closure, JSFunction::kCodeOffset, scratch1, scratch2, in ReplaceClosureCodeWithOptimizedCode()
/third_party/node/deps/v8/src/builtins/mips64/
H A Dbuiltins-mips64.cc462 __ Ld(a2, FieldMemOperand(a1, JSFunction::kCodeOffset)); in Generate_ResumeGeneratorTrampoline()
819 __ Sd(optimized_code, FieldMemOperand(closure, JSFunction::kCodeOffset)); in ReplaceClosureCodeWithOptimizedCode()
821 __ RecordWriteField(closure, JSFunction::kCodeOffset, scratch1, scratch2, in ReplaceClosureCodeWithOptimizedCode()
/third_party/node/deps/v8/src/builtins/ppc/
H A Dbuiltins-ppc.cc745 __ LoadTaggedPointerField(r5, FieldMemOperand(r4, JSFunction::kCodeOffset), in Generate_ResumeGeneratorTrampoline()
1086 FieldMemOperand(closure, JSFunction::kCodeOffset), r0); in ReplaceClosureCodeWithOptimizedCode()
1091 __ RecordWriteField(closure, JSFunction::kCodeOffset, value, slot_address, in ReplaceClosureCodeWithOptimizedCode()
/third_party/node/deps/v8/src/builtins/ia32/
H A Dbuiltins-ia32.cc743 __ mov(ecx, FieldOperand(edi, JSFunction::kCodeOffset)); in Generate_ResumeGeneratorTrampoline()
785 __ mov(FieldOperand(closure, JSFunction::kCodeOffset), optimized_code); in ReplaceClosureCodeWithOptimizedCode()
787 __ RecordWriteField(closure, JSFunction::kCodeOffset, value, slot_address, in ReplaceClosureCodeWithOptimizedCode()
/third_party/node/deps/v8/src/builtins/loong64/
H A Dbuiltins-loong64.cc464 __ Ld_d(a2, FieldMemOperand(a1, JSFunction::kCodeOffset)); in Generate_ResumeGeneratorTrampoline()
815 __ St_d(optimized_code, FieldMemOperand(closure, JSFunction::kCodeOffset)); in ReplaceClosureCodeWithOptimizedCode()
816 __ RecordWriteField(closure, JSFunction::kCodeOffset, optimized_code, in ReplaceClosureCodeWithOptimizedCode()
/third_party/node/deps/v8/src/builtins/x64/
H A Dbuiltins-x64.cc839 __ LoadTaggedPointerField(rcx, FieldOperand(rdi, JSFunction::kCodeOffset)); in Generate_ResumeGeneratorTrampoline()
886 __ StoreTaggedField(FieldOperand(closure, JSFunction::kCodeOffset), in ReplaceClosureCodeWithOptimizedCode()
892 __ RecordWriteField(closure, JSFunction::kCodeOffset, value, slot_address, in ReplaceClosureCodeWithOptimizedCode()
/third_party/node/deps/v8/src/builtins/arm64/
H A Dbuiltins-arm64.cc582 __ LoadTaggedPointerField(x2, FieldMemOperand(x1, JSFunction::kCodeOffset)); in Generate_ResumeGeneratorTrampoline()
1004 FieldMemOperand(closure, JSFunction::kCodeOffset)); in ReplaceClosureCodeWithOptimizedCode()
1005 __ RecordWriteField(closure, JSFunction::kCodeOffset, optimized_code, in ReplaceClosureCodeWithOptimizedCode()
/third_party/node/deps/v8/src/builtins/arm/
H A Dbuiltins-arm.cc477 __ ldr(r2, FieldMemOperand(r1, JSFunction::kCodeOffset)); in Generate_ResumeGeneratorTrampoline()
838 __ str(optimized_code, FieldMemOperand(closure, JSFunction::kCodeOffset)); in ReplaceClosureCodeWithOptimizedCode()
839 __ RecordWriteField(closure, JSFunction::kCodeOffset, optimized_code, in ReplaceClosureCodeWithOptimizedCode()
/third_party/node/deps/v8/src/builtins/riscv64/
H A Dbuiltins-riscv64.cc494 __ LoadTaggedPointerField(a2, FieldMemOperand(a1, JSFunction::kCodeOffset)); in Generate_ResumeGeneratorTrampoline()
861 FieldMemOperand(closure, JSFunction::kCodeOffset)); in ReplaceClosureCodeWithOptimizedCode()
863 __ RecordWriteField(closure, JSFunction::kCodeOffset, scratch1, in ReplaceClosureCodeWithOptimizedCode()
/third_party/node/deps/v8/src/builtins/s390/
H A Dbuiltins-s390.cc720 __ LoadTaggedPointerField(r4, FieldMemOperand(r3, JSFunction::kCodeOffset)); in Generate_ResumeGeneratorTrampoline()
1121 FieldMemOperand(closure, JSFunction::kCodeOffset), r0); in ReplaceClosureCodeWithOptimizedCode()
1126 __ RecordWriteField(closure, JSFunction::kCodeOffset, value, slot_address, in ReplaceClosureCodeWithOptimizedCode()
/third_party/node/deps/v8/src/codegen/ia32/
H A Dmacro-assembler-ia32.cc1409 mov(ecx, FieldOperand(function, JSFunction::kCodeOffset)); in CallRecordWriteStub()

Completed in 95 milliseconds

12